The legend tells us that around 1979, after intense activity as artist on the road, from around New York, Laraaji found in the case of his electrified zither, a Brian Eno's visiting card who wished to meet him. After that meeting, Eno produced "Day of radiance" the third chapter of his precious "Ambient #" series and the first of Laraaji's several successful cds.
Laraaji's main instrument is the zither, an instrument similar to a cithara with free strings on a wooden sound box. From a purely acoustic instrument he made it into an electric one in order to expand the reverberations and the pure notes he was able to extract.
He played and registered with Bill Nelson, Brian Eno, Bill Laswell, Roger Eno, Harold Budd, Nana Vasconcelos, Vernon Reid, Haroumi Hosono, Kate St John, Audio Active, and many others. With "My orangeness" Laraaji comes back with a solo scented of incense and other aromatic spices. A very enjoyable and relaxing but also deep work in which he's accompanied by beautiful musicians who enrich with new colors his palette of freely played strings.
